Hi have just noticed that my verso is losing water through its expansion bottle. I know the 2.2 has a head gasket problem. Have taken the plastic cover off the head and there are no pink marks on the inside. Have also checked the Water and it is showing no signs.

When I switch the air con on the fans kick in so they is life in them.

However I checked earlier when the engine was warm with the air con off and they didn't kick in while I watched for about 15 minutes.

Could this be a faulty sensor or the dreaded head gasket?

The heating still works.

Any help would be appreciated.

It's also possible that the water pump may be weeping - tbh that's probably a more common issue than hg failure.

If that is the fault & you are aware of it, keep an eye on the coolant & top it up as needed you can probably live with it - of course it depends upon just how much it is losing. On my previous 57 plate 2.2 Avensis I lived with it for ~1 year with it being replaced foc under warranty just before I sold the car.
